I am shortly going to tile my bathroom floor with porcerline tiles 48x53x10cm what is the minimum thickness of plywood needed
 
If you're overboarding floorboards, use 12mm ply screwed every 200mm. If replacing floorboards, I recommend using 25mm ply and add support (noggins) between joists under the joints in the ply. Ply should be exterior (WBP) grade.
